Am29LV065M
64 Megabit (8 M x 8-Bit) MirrorBit 3.0 Volt-only
Uniform Sector Flash Memory with VersatileI/O Control
DISTINCTIVE CHARACTERISTICS
ARCHITECTURAL ADVANTAGES
s
Single power supply operation
— 3 volt read, erase, and program operations
s
Enhanced VersatileI/O control
— Device generates data output voltages and tolerates
data input voltages as determined by the voltage on
the V
IO
pin; operates from 1.65 to 3.6 V
s
Manufactured on 0.23 µm MirrorBit process
technology
s
SecSi (Secured Silicon) Sector region
— 256-byte sector for permanent, secure identification
through an 16-byte random Electronic Serial Number,
accessible through a command sequence
— May be programmed and locked at the factory or by
the customer
s
Flexible sector architecture
— One hundred twenty-eight 64 Kbyte sectors
s
Compatibility with JEDEC standards
— Provides pinout and software compatibility for
single-power supply flash, and superior inadvertent
write protection
s
Minimum 100,000 erase cycle guarantee per sector
s
20-year data retention at 125°C
PERFORMANCE CHARACTERISTICS
s
High performance
— 90 ns access time
— 25 ns page read times
— 0.4 s typical sector erase time
— 3.0 µs typical write buffer byte programming time:
32-byte write buffer reduces overall programming
time for multiple-byte updates
— 8-byte read page buffer
— 32-byte write buffer
s
Low power consumption (typical values at 3.0 V,
5 MHz)
— 30 mA typical active read current
— 50 mA typical erase/program current
— 1 µA typical standby mode current
s
Package options
— 48-pin TSOP
— 63-ball FBGA
SOFTWARE & HARDWARE FEATURES
s
Software features
— Program Suspend & Resume: read other sectors
before programming operation is completed
— Erase Suspend & Resume: read/program other
sectors before an erase operation is completed
— Data# polling & toggle bits provide status
— Unlock Bypass Program command reduces overall
multiple-byte programming time
— CFI (Common Flash Interface) compliant: allows host
system to identify and accommodate multiple flash
devices
s
Hardware features
— Sector Group Protection: hardware method of
preventing write operations within a sector group
— Temporary Sector Unprotect: V
ID
-level method of
changing code in locked sectors
— ACC (high voltage) pin accelerates programming
time for higher throughput during system production
— Hardware reset pin (RESET#) resets device
— Ready/Busy# pin (RY/BY#) detects program or erase
cycle completion
